And how should that signal be interpreted if only the classical signature
on it could be validated?

On Mon, Jul 27, 2026 at 3:51=E2=80=AFPM Shumon Huque <[email protected]> wro=
te:

> On Mon, Jul 27, 2026 at 9:07=E2=80=AFAM Paul Hoffman <paul.hoffman@icann.=
org>
> wrote:
>
>> On Jul 27, 2026, at 05:51, Shumon Huque <[email protected]> wrote:
>> >
>> > A new validator implementation could unilaterally impose that rule,
>> sure.
>>
>> And it might. That would require that the validator had such a knob in
>> its config, and would be implementation-specific.
>>
>> > But ideally, there should be some general rule for algorithm downgrade
>> resistance that is signaled in the protocol, rather than special casing =
a
>> rule only for a specific algorithm.
>>
>> THERE BE DRAGONS!
>>
>> It is probably fine to have a signal that says "do not downgrade from
>> {set of PQ algorithms} to {set of classical algorithms}, but a signal th=
at
>> says 'do not downgrade from {PQ alg 1} to {PQ alg 2} is inherently
>> dangerous because if alg 1 becomes weakened by a later attack, you have
>> just created a signal that basically forces a downgrade.
>>
>
> Yes, I agree. I would not propose per algorithm rules. So, some options
> might be: (1) All algorithm signatures must validate, (2) PQ algorithms
> can't be downgraded, (3) both PQ and Classical algorithms must validate.
>
> Shumon.
